Alloy SuperDuplex / 1.4501

Super Duplex S32760/ F55 , Super Duplex Alloy UNS S32760 (F55 / 1.4501) has excellent resistance Pitting and Crevice Corrosion in seawater at elevated temperatures, supplied with a PREN 40<( Pitting Resistance Eqv) . Excellent resistance to SCC ( Stress Corrosion Cracking) in Sour and Chloride environments .

Providing higher strengths than both austenitic and 22% Cr Duplex Stainless Steels UNS S32760 (F55) is suited to a variety of applications in industries such as Oil & Gas, CPI(Chemical Processing Industries), and Marine environments.

UNS S32760 (F55 / 1.4501) is listed in NACE MR 01 75 for sour service and having gained ASME Approval for Pressure Vessel applications.

Specifications

  • EN 10088-3 1.4501
  • ASTM A473 UNS S32760 Forgings
  • ASTM A182 Grade F55 UNS S32760 Forged Flanges
  • ASTM A240 UNS S32760 Sheet and Plate
  • ASTM A479 UNS S32760 Bar
  • ASTM A276 UNS S32760 Condition A
  • NACE MR 01-75
